Windows PS Emulation Driver features (for Windows 98 SE and Windows Me) This section provides information about the features of the HP PS traditional driver. The following information is provided: ● HP postscript level 3 emulation support ● Access to print-driver settings in Windows 98 SE and Windows Me ● Paper ● Graphics ● Device Options ● PostScript HP postscript level 3 emulation support A set of 92 PS Level 3 soft fonts is included with the printing-system software. If you want to permanently install the fonts in the printer, HP postscript level 3 emulation fonts are also available from HP in an optional font DIMM. The HP postscript level 3 emulation maintains full compatibility with Adobe PS Level 3 when PS Level 3 soft fonts are purchased from Adobe. Users of Adobe-licensed software might also have the right to use the Adobe PS level 3 print drivers from Adobe with the HP LaserJet printer postscript level 3 emulation PPD, which is available on the HP LaserJet 3050/3052/3055/3390/3392 all-in-one printing-system software CD or from the HP Web site. When using the Adobe PS Level 3 print driver, users must comply with all Adobe licensing agreements, as stated on the Adobe Web site at www.adobe.com/support/downloads/license.html. Access to print-driver settings in Windows 98 SE and Windows Me To gain access to the PS Emulation Driver tabs in Windows 98 SE and Windows Me, click Start, click Settings, and then click Printers. Right-click the product name, and then click Properties to gain access to all print-driver tabs. The settings that you make on these driver tabs control print-job output.
